区块链设施层是区块链技术的基础架构,负责支

        时间:2025-08-01 21:20:33

        主页 > 加密货币 >

          区块链设施层是区块链技术的基础架构,负责支持和增强区块链的核心功能。以下是区块链设施层的几个重要组成部分:

节点
节点是区块链网络中的基本单位,每个节点都保存了区块链的一个完整副本。节点可以是全节点(保存整个区块链历史)或轻节点(只保存部分信息)。节点之间通过去中心化网络进行通信,共同维护区块链的完整性和安全性。

共识机制
共识机制是确保区块链网络中所有节点同步状态和达成一致的重要过程。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等。不同的共识机制在安全性、效率和中心化程度上存在差异。

数据结构
区块链中的数据结构是由多个区块以链式结构相连,每个区块包含一个时间戳、交易信息、前一个区块的哈希值等。数据结构的设计确保了区块链的不可篡改性和安全性。

智能合约
智能合约是一种自动执行、控制和文档化法律相关事务的计算机协议。它们在区块链上执行,能够大大降低交易成本和时间。智能合约是区块链的一个重要扩展层,支持各种去中心化应用(DApps)的开发。

网络协议
网络协议是区块链节点之间交流的“语言”。它定义了节点如何发现彼此、传输数据、验证交易等基本操作。比如比特币网络使用的是自己的协议,而以太坊则基于不同的协议。

加密算法
加密算法在区块链中扮演着至关重要的角色,确保数据传输的安全性和用户身份的隐私。常用的加密算法有SHA-256(比特币使用)和Ethash(以太坊使用)。这些算法确保了区块链数据的安全性和不可篡改性。

用户界面和交互层
尽管并不直接属于区块链的设施层,但用户界面和交互层对于区块链的推广和使用至关重要。用户友好的界面可以让普通用户更容易理解和使用区块链技术,促进其在实际生活中的应用。

存储和数据管理
在区块链系统中,存储和数据管理是至关重要的组成部分。区块链记录了大量的交易数据,因此必须有高效的存储机制来保持数据的完整性和安全性。不同的区块链可能使用不同的存储方式来管理数据。

以上这些组成部分共同构成了区块链的设施层,使得区块链技术能够安全、高效地运作。理解这些组成部分有助于更好地把握区块链技术的全貌和实际应用。若你对区块链技术想要更深入的了解,欢迎继续关注相关资料和更新。区块链设施层是区块链技术的基础架构,负责支持和增强区块链的核心功能。以下是区块链设施层的几个重要组成部分:

节点
节点是区块链网络中的基本单位,每个节点都保存了区块链的一个完整副本。节点可以是全节点(保存整个区块链历史)或轻节点(只保存部分信息)。节点之间通过去中心化网络进行通信,共同维护区块链的完整性和安全性。

共识机制
共识机制是确保区块链网络中所有节点同步状态和达成一致的重要过程。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等。不同的共识机制在安全性、效率和中心化程度上存在差异。

数据结构
区块链中的数据结构是由多个区块以链式结构相连,每个区块包含一个时间戳、交易信息、前一个区块的哈希值等。数据结构的设计确保了区块链的不可篡改性和安全性。

智能合约
智能合约是一种自动执行、控制和文档化法律相关事务的计算机协议。它们在区块链上执行,能够大大降低交易成本和时间。智能合约是区块链的一个重要扩展层,支持各种去中心化应用(DApps)的开发。

网络协议
网络协议是区块链节点之间交流的“语言”。它定义了节点如何发现彼此、传输数据、验证交易等基本操作。比如比特币网络使用的是自己的协议,而以太坊则基于不同的协议。

加密算法
加密算法在区块链中扮演着至关重要的角色,确保数据传输的安全性和用户身份的隐私。常用的加密算法有SHA-256(比特币使用)和Ethash(以太坊使用)。这些算法确保了区块链数据的安全性和不可篡改性。

用户界面和交互层
尽管并不直接属于区块链的设施层,但用户界面和交互层对于区块链的推广和使用至关重要。用户友好的界面可以让普通用户更容易理解和使用区块链技术,促进其在实际生活中的应用。

存储和数据管理
在区块链系统中,存储和数据管理是至关重要的组成部分。区块链记录了大量的交易数据,因此必须有高效的存储机制来保持数据的完整性和安全性。不同的区块链可能使用不同的存储方式来管理数据。

以上这些组成部分共同构成了区块链的设施层,使得区块链技术能够安全、高效地运作。理解这些组成部分有助于更好地把握区块链技术的全貌和实际应用。若你对区块链技术想要更深入的了解,欢迎继续关注相关资料和更新。
          <acronym date-time="1uv4pp"></acronym><noframes id="90gpz8">